在当今数字化时代,数据成为企业最为宝贵的资产之一。而随着企业对数据依赖程度的增加,如何确保数据的完整性和安全性成为管理者关注的核心问题之一。在这一背景下,RPO(恢复点目标)的概念逐渐进入人们的视野,并成为企业数据管理策略中不可或缺的一部分。RPO对数据完整性究竟有何影响?本文将从多个角度进行详细探讨。
我们需要了解RPO的基本定义。RPO指的是在发生数据丢失事件时,企业希望恢复到的最远时间点。这一目标决定了企业在灾难发生时可能丢失的最大数据量。举例来说,如果企业设置的RPO为24小时,那么在发生数据丢失时,企业可能会丢失最多24小时的数据。因此,RPO的设定直接影响了企业在数据灾难后的恢复能力,以及数据完整性的保障程度。
RPO对数据完整性的重要性体现在数据的连续性和一致性上。数据完整性指的是数据在传输、存储和处理过程中不被篡改、丢失或损坏的状态。对于企业来说,数据完整性不仅仅是数据没有丢失或损坏,更是确保数据的一致性和准确性。在实际操作中,由于系统故障、网络攻击或人为错误等原因,数据丢失在所难免。这时,RPO就成为衡量企业数据恢复能力的重要指标之一。一个合理的RPO能够确保企业在最短时间内恢复到灾难发生前的数据状态,从而最大程度上保证数据的完整性和连续性。
不同的企业和业务对RPO的要求各不相同。例如,金融行业对数据完整性有极高要求,因为每一笔交易的数据都至关重要,任何数据丢失或篡改都可能带来严重后果。因此,金融企业通常会设定较短的RPO,以确保数据的完整性。而对于一些对数据实时性要求不高的企业,如制造业或物流业,RPO可以适当延长,但仍需确保在合理的范围内,以避免过度的数据丢失。
RPO的设定不仅影响企业的数据完整性,还直接关系到灾难恢复的效率与成本。在实际操作中,较短的RPO意味着企业需要更频繁地进行数据备份,以确保灾难发生时可以恢复到尽可能接近当前的状态。这种情况下,企业可能需要投入更多的资源,如存储设备、带宽和人力等。因此,企业在设定RPO时需要在数据完整性和成本之间找到平衡点。
RPO的设定还需要考虑到企业的业务连续性计划(BCP)。BCP是指企业在遭遇灾难时,如何在最短时间内恢复关键业务的规划和措施。RPO作为BCP的关键指标之一,直接影响了企业的业务恢复时间。例如,在电商行业,如果RPO设定过长,可能会导致大量订单数据丢失,进而影响客户体验和企业声誉。因此,企业在制定RPO时,必须结合业务特点、数据重要性以及潜在的风险,制定一个既经济又高效的RPO方案。
在实际应用中,企业可以通过多种方式优化RPO,以提升数据完整性。例如,采用混合云备份方案,将重要数据同时存储在本地和云端,既能确保数据安全,又能提高恢复速度。企业还可以引入自动化备份工具,减少人为操作带来的错误风险。定期进行数据恢复演练也是确保RPO有效性的重要手段,通过模拟各种灾难场景,验证RPO设定的合理性,并及时调整策略。
总结来看,RPO对数据完整性的影响不可忽视。它不仅是衡量企业灾难恢复能力的重要指标,更是保障数据安全与业务连续性的关键因素。企业在设定RPO时,必须全面考虑数据的重要性、业务需求以及灾难恢复成本等多方面因素,确保RPO既能满足业务需求,又不至于给企业带来过重的成本负担。通过合理的RPO设定和有效的数据管理策略,企业可以最大程度地保障数据完整性,为自身的可持续发展奠定坚实基础。